The food was Wonder Dogs, Hero Sandwiches, All sort of fruits (They had signs that described the superhero strengths you would get when eating them), we also had cheeto puff that we "power puffs" and Bugels which were "Cat woman's claws". I got some green punch and added dry ice to it which made "Joker Juice" (this actually turned out really good and everyone drank it super fast.

When the kids arrived it was so hot we let them swim first. After swimming we ate some food. Once everyone was done eating the kids were issued their super hero uniforms and were ready for super hero training camp. ( I made capes, masks and cuffs for all 18 kids) We had fun stations like test your strength and they punch throw tissue paper. Agility was tested by jumping over buildings (which Eli painted). The buildings ending up being a little too big for most kids so if they said Blueberry (which was the berry that gave you this power) then Jacob and I would help them rocket higher. Jacob dressed up like the Candy Caper and I told the kids he stole candy from a baby. They chased him down with their super speed and got the candy back. We also had the kids line up and run across the yard avoiding bombs (water balloons). They tested their bravery by sticking their hand in goop and saving the little dinos. (The goop was jello and red. It got all over my legs. Jacob and Spencer saw this as a great time to joke the my water has broke). The kids seemed to really love it and so did Eli.
